Bioinformatics Data Scientist
GRAILData Scientist analyzing genomic datasets to uncover signals and model cancer biology for early detection innovation. Working cross-functionally with experts to strengthen test performance.

About the role
Key responsibilities & impact- Analyze and interpret large-scale NGS datasets to identify biological and molecular patterns of cancers related to cancer detection
- Design, implement and validate innovative statistical methods and machine learning models to extract and interpret cancer genomic signals for product innovation
- Work closely with interdisciplinary teams (computational, clinical, assay development, and product) to translate data-driven insights to actionable decisions
- Present and communicate high-quality, evidence-based research findings with clarity and rigor
Requirements
What you’ll need- Ph.D. in Cancer Genomics, Statistics, Bioinformatics, Computational Biology, Data Science, Engineering or a related field.
- Proven track record in working with large-scale omics datasets in R or Python.
- Proven expertise in genomics — excellent knowledge and hands-on experience on genomics technologies and analysis methods.
- Familiarity with NGS data processing, statistical modeling, and machine learning frameworks (e.g., scikit-learn, TensorFlow, PyTorch).
- Excellent communication, collaboration, and problem-solving skills; ability to work effectively in interdisciplinary environments.
